Finally got around to checking Bastion off of my ‘2011 games I wanted to play, but forgot about’. Loved it…especially the storyline and narration. Simple concept, wonderfully stylized graphics, incredible easy to learn/hard to master game play. Had a very Braid feel to it. And now to sit back and relax until Mass Effect 3 launches. One more month…I can almost see the delayed comic apologies. Almost.